But before you set your heart on a specific cosmetic dentistry procedure, it’s a good concept to understand your choices. Listed below we’ve detailed the six most typical cosmetic dental procedures, with the benefits and drawbacks of each.

Full Crown, For A More Comprehensive Fix

Like a veneer, a crown is a long-term layer that adheres directly to your teeth. Unlike veneers, crowns cover the entire surface area of your teeth, including the backs. Though they hide imperfections and enhance a weak tooth, crowns do need attention to oral hygiene in the form of regular flossing.

Veneers, For A Sparkling Smile

Technically a partial crown, a veneer is a thin product (frequently dental porcelain) that completely adheres directly to the front of the tooth. Often utilized in Cosmetic Dentist in Winnetka to develop a Hollywood-worthy smile that exposes no fractures or staining, veneers are convenient due to the fact that they can maintain your natural tooth structure. That said, not everyone is a candidate for veneers. If your teeth are crowded or severely mal-positioned, your bite can determine whether or not veneers are a sensible solution.

For A Single Missing Tooth, A Simple Bridge Will Do

In Cosmetic Dentist in Winnetka, a bridge is a fast and practical repair for an awkward space in your teeth. A bridge works by relying on the teeth adjacent to the missing out on tooth as support for the incorrect tooth inserted between. Compared to an implant, a bridge is normally the quicker long-term solution for a missing tooth. That said, if either of the supporting teeth for a bridge has issues, the stability of the entire bridge is threatened.

When In Doubt, Opt For An Implant

Like a bridge, an implant is utilized to change a missing tooth. Unlike their long-term equivalents, freestanding implants don’t rely on neighboring teeth and can be managed as specific units. The disadvantage is that it’s a service that typically takes a bit longer to proceed. Candidates for cosmetic dentistry implants must be screened for general health. Likewise, the bone at the possible implant site must be fully recovered before the implant can be positioned.
